在 Vue 的開發(fā)過程中,我們會使用到一些工具來加快開發(fā)效率和優(yōu)化代碼性能。其中一個重要的工具就是生產(chǎn)包還原,它可以將我們的 Vue 項目打包成一個更小更快的生產(chǎn)版本,用于在實際生產(chǎn)環(huán)境中使用。
當(dāng)我們使用 Vue 進行開發(fā)時,通過 webpack 將我們的代碼打包成了一個 JavaScript 文件,在開發(fā)環(huán)境中使用時是包含了一些調(diào)試和開發(fā)時才需要的代碼,這些代碼大部分在生產(chǎn)環(huán)境中是不需要的,因為這些代碼會讓頁面加載速度變慢,并且會占用過多的帶寬和資源。
因此,我們需要使用生產(chǎn)包還原來生成一個優(yōu)化后的生產(chǎn)版本,這個版本只包含了真正需要的代碼,從而可以提高頁面加載速度和響應(yīng)速度,為用戶提供更好的體驗。
npm run build
在我們的 Vue 項目中,我們可以使用npm run build
命令來構(gòu)建生產(chǎn)包還原,它會將我們的項目打包成一個可用于實際生產(chǎn)環(huán)境的版本。這個命令可以在命令行中執(zhí)行,也可以通過使用一些可視化工具來執(zhí)行。
在執(zhí)行npm run build
命令之后,webpack 會生成一些壓縮過的代碼文件,這些文件是經(jīng)過壓縮和優(yōu)化過的,能夠讓頁面加載速度更快,同時也可以減少帶寬和資源的使用。
在生產(chǎn)包還原生成后,我們的項目就可以部署到實際的生產(chǎn)環(huán)境中使用了。這個過程中需要注意一些事項,比如需要使用 HTTPS 協(xié)議來保護用戶的信息安全,同時也需要使用一些其他的工具來對網(wǎng)頁進行性能優(yōu)化和安全保護。
如果我們需要在生產(chǎn)環(huán)境中進行一些調(diào)試和開發(fā)工作,我們可以使用npm run dev
命令來啟動一個調(diào)試服務(wù),這個過程中會包含一些開發(fā)時需要的代碼和工具。
總的來說,Vue 的生產(chǎn)包還原是一個非常重要的工具,它可以讓我們的項目更加高效和優(yōu)化,同時也可以提高用戶的體驗和安全性。在使用這個工具時需要注意一些事項,以便能夠得到最好的結(jié)果。